A convergence analysis for the nonsymmetric Lanczos algorithm is presented. By using a tridiagonal structure of the algorithm, some identities concerning Ritz values and Ritz vectors are established and used to derive approximation bounds. In particular, the analysis implies the classical results for the symmetric Lanczos algorithm.

Gradient iterations for the Rayleigh quotient are simple and robust solvers to determine a few of the smallest eigenvalues together with the associated eigenvectors of (generalized) matrix eigenvalue problems for symmetric matrices.
